#939cad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#939cad is composed of 57.6% red, 61.2%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15% cyan, 9.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 219.2 degrees, a saturation of 13.7% and a lightness of 62.7%. #939cad color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#27395b.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

#939cad color description : Dark grayish blue.

#939cad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#939cad has RGB values of R:147, G:156, B:173 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 9673901.

Shades and Tints of #939cad

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030303 is the darkest color, while #f7f8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#939cad

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9a9ea6 is the less saturated color, while #4383fd is the most saturated one.
